Maritime Museum Zilversluis (fully covered + cafe)
- Address: Kademuseum 3, 1234 AB Zilversluis
- Distance: approx. 650 meters • 8 minutes walk
- Opening hours: Wednesday to Sunday 10:00–17:00 (closed Monday and Tuesday)
- Price: Adults €9.00 • Children 6–17 years €5.00 • Under 6 free
- Accessibility: Elevator available • Barrier‑free sanitary facilities
- Booking: Not required; can be busy on weekends
- Season: Year‑round • Special programs during school holidays
Why go: This is the go‑to all‑weather attraction steps from the harbor promenade. With a fully covered layout and an on‑site cafe, you can linger for a slow morning or an educational afternoon without watching the forecast.

Accessibility and practical details
- Wheelchair access: The harbor promenade and the Maritime Museum are accessible (note some cobblestones outside). The City Tower is not accessible. Boat trips are possible on request with guidance.
- Weather closures: In heavy rain or storms, the City Tower and river cruises may close. The Maritime Museum and the hotel lounge are reliable indoor alternatives.
- Reception support: Daily 07:00–22:00 at the desk; reachable 24/7 by phone. The team can check opening times, print or email maps, and make restaurant or activity reservations.

If the weather eases up later
- Boat trips on the river: 75‑minute cruises from the harbor promenade pier (4 minutes’ walk) at 11:00 • 13:00 • 15:00 on Saturday and Sunday (April to October). Adults €14.00 • Children €8.00 • Family (2+2) €40.00. Reservation recommended in good weather.
- City Tower (view & tours): Approx. 900 meters (12 minutes walk). Open Saturday and Sunday 11:00–16:00 with hourly tours (March to October). Adults €4.00 • Children €2.00. Stairs only; closed in bad weather.
